  • Machine Learning Best Practices for Public Sector Organizations
    In some cases, such as with edge devices, inferencing needs to occur even when there is limited or no connectivity to the cloud. Mining fields are an example of this type of use case. AWS IoT Greengrass enables ML inference locally using models that are created, trained, and optimized in the cloud using Amazon SageMaker, AWS Deep Learning AMI, or AWS Deep Learning Containers, and deployed on the edge devices. - Source: dev.to / over 2 years ago
